Output 68a5676ddec51f2cb5942e4588dc0907cbd4c35616182b0bde8c932f3abb39e0:1

value
705989400
script pubkey
OP_0 OP_PUSHBYTES_20 a176e3346a44a423753dec48781ea310a4ccaddc
address
ltc1q59mwxdr2gjjzxafaa3y8s84rzzjvetwuklcjf0
transaction
68a5676ddec51f2cb5942e4588dc0907cbd4c35616182b0bde8c932f3abb39e0
spent
true